NOTD: NYX Advanced Salon Formula - Enchanted Forest

So, I've been sporting boring plain-Jane nude nails for the past couple of weeks, which reflected my mood at the time (being bombarded with exams and stress).

Now that the books are closed and "school's out"! It's time for a nail makeover I'd say!
After rummaging through my fairly adequate collection of nail polishes, I encountered a beautiful emerald dream, encapsulated in a geometric NYX Advanced Salon Formula bottle.

This so called "dream" is entitled, Enchanted Forest, which I believe is most fitting for such a lovely shade!



I hope you envisioned a similar shade to what I just showed you!
Enchanted Forest is an extravagant marriage between dark green and gold glitters, bounded by a blue-green base.

The effect on my nails is breathtakingly stunning; you will need two generous coats to achieve this.
In terms wear time, I've experienced chipping on the second day due to laborious activities involving water and my hands.

A great average polish that has been part of my collection ever since the day I received my package from Cherry Culture.

I'll be looking forward to exploring more of these NYX polishes.
